TEMPEST.114 Posted October 6, 2022 Posted October 6, 2022 I'd like to write a script that generates random sea traffic that travels to/from ports, but I'm struggling to find anything in the scripting engine or mission editor that specifies ports/harbours. Is the only way to do this manually creating trigger zones per map?
Hairdo1-1 Posted October 6, 2022 Posted October 6, 2022 I’ve found most of the water at ports isn’t deep enough for bigger ships so you need to have the traffic spawn outside of it. I accomplish this by using moose spawn
Grimes Posted October 6, 2022 Posted October 6, 2022 No. Outside of specific world objects on each map there is nothing in the context of a port. Across the different maps there aren't a ton of them to exist to begin with, so manually figuring it out purely from traveling from point A to point B its not to bad.
